Bio:

Jaclyn “Jax” Scott has nearly 15 years of combined IT and cyber experience and is an executive leader in Global Cyber Intelligence, Cybersecurity, and Electronic Warfare. She is a cybersecurity manager at Grant Thornton who assists companies in protecting their critical assets and securing their infrastructure.

She is the Chief Content Officer for the tech blog and global YouTube channel Outpost Gray. Jax co-hosts the rapidly growing cybersecurity podcast 2CyberChicks, hosted by ITSPMagazine. She serves in the Army reserves and is a tenured Army Special Operations Warrant Officer in Cyber, Electronic Warfare, and Information Operations.

She published a cybersecurity book called “Cybersecurity Career Master Plan” and is pursuing her master’s in Cybersecurity at Georgetown University.
